谁都知道该图像的存储位置,如果不是某种标准格式(.gif,.jpg等),将其与其他内容交换会涉及什么?
#1 楼
为此,您需要重新编译内核。创建不超过224种颜色且尺寸为80x80px的图像。
保存图像作为png,然后运行以下命令(前提是您已安装
netpbm
并在/usr/src/linux
中提供了内核源代码):$ pngtopnm logo.png | ppmquant -fs 223 | pnmtoplainpnm> logo_linux_clut224.ppm
$ cp logo_linux_clut224.ppm / usr / src / linux / drivers / video / logo /
重新编译并安装新内核。
评论
当我为该图像使用多于224种颜色和/或不是80 x 80px的图像时会发生什么?
– BrainStone
18/12/21在15:34
评论
据我所知,它至少需要重新编译内核。我不知道你是否会做到这一点。我当然不会。或者,您可以在引导时运行fbi并将图像显示在屏幕上。只要确保图像在文本将要出现的部分为黑色即可。